On Mon, 1 Sep 2025 19:48:57 +0800 you wrote:
> Extract the dst lookup logic from ipip6_tunnel_xmit() into new helper
> ipip6_tunnel_dst_find() to reduce code duplication and enhance readability.
> No functional change intended.
>
> On a x86_64, with allmodconfig object size is also reduced:
>
> ./scripts/bloat-o-meter net/ipv6/sit.o net/ipv6/sit-new.o
> add/remove: 5/3 grow/shrink: 3/4 up/down: 1841/-2275 (-434)
> Function old new delta
> ipip6_tunnel_dst_find - 1697 +1697
> __pfx_ipip6_tunnel_dst_find - 64 +64
> __UNIQUE_ID_modinfo2094 - 43 +43
> ipip6_tunnel_xmit.isra.cold 79 88 +9
> __UNIQUE_ID_modinfo2096 12 20 +8
> __UNIQUE_ID___addressable_init_module2092 - 8 +8
> __UNIQUE_ID___addressable_cleanup_module2093 - 8 +8
> __func__ 55 59 +4
> __UNIQUE_ID_modinfo2097 20 18 -2
> __UNIQUE_ID___addressable_init_module2093 8 - -8
> __UNIQUE_ID___addressable_cleanup_module2094 8 - -8
> __UNIQUE_ID_modinfo2098 18 - -18
> __UNIQUE_ID_modinfo2095 43 12 -31
> descriptor 112 56 -56
> ipip6_tunnel_xmit.isra 9910 7758 -2152
> Total: Before=72537, After=72103, chg -0.60%
